Into the Heart of Meghalaya: A Journey Begins
The moment I touched down in Guwahati, the air was thick with anticipation. My heart raced as I embarked on the Assam-Meghalaya-Arunachal Adventure, a 10-day odyssey through the rugged terrains and lush landscapes of Northeast India. Our first destination was the mystical land of Meghalaya, a place that promised to test my limits and reward my senses.
Our guide, Mr. Bikramjit, was a beacon of knowledge and enthusiasm. He led us to the famed double-decker living root bridge and Rainbow Falls, a trek that demanded every ounce of my endurance. The path was steep and challenging, but the sight of the ancient root bridges intertwined with nature’s artistry was worth every drop of sweat. As we ventured deeper into the heart of Cherrapunjee, the misty mountains and cascading waterfalls enveloped us in their ethereal embrace. Each step was a dance with nature, a reminder of the raw beauty that lay beyond the beaten path.
The short treks to Kransuri and Phe Phe Falls were equally mesmerizing. The crystal-clear waters glistened under the sun, a rare sight that left me in awe. It was a reminder of why I chase these adventures, the thrill of discovering untouched beauty in the most unexpected places.
Kaziranga: A Wild Encounter
Leaving the enchanting landscapes of Meghalaya behind, we journeyed to the wild heart of Assam—Kaziranga National Park. Our base was the Zakai Eco Camp, a rustic haven owned by Mr. Bikramjit himself. The camp was a gateway to the wilderness, offering a village-centric atmosphere that felt like a step back in time.
The safaris were nothing short of exhilarating. As we ventured into the park, the anticipation of spotting the elusive tiger kept my adrenaline pumping. The sight of the majestic creature in its natural habitat was a moment of pure awe, a testament to the untamed beauty of the wild. Kaziranga is also home to the iconic single-horned rhinos, and witnessing these gentle giants roam freely was a humbling experience.
Our guide, Mr. Himanta Bora, was a treasure trove of local knowledge. He took us to the banks of the mighty Brahmaputra, a river so vast it seemed to merge with the horizon. The experience was surreal, a reminder of nature’s grandeur and the adventures that await those willing to explore its depths.
